AIA NEW JERSEY
2017 SERVICE AWARD RECIPIENTS
Architect of the Year Award
Ben P. Lee, AIA
Firm of the Year Award
HDR
Young Architect of the Year
Matthew Fink, AIA
Intern Architect of the Year
Joshua Barnett, Associate AIA
Resident of the Year Award
Richard Bettini, Associate AIA
Distinguished Service Award
Kimberly Bunn, AIA

Architects are creative professionals, educated, trained, and experienced in the art and science of building design, and licensed to practice architecture. Their designs respond to client needs, wants and vision, protect public safety, provide economic value, are innovative, inspire and contribute positively to the community and the environment.
